It is an antidote, mainly used for the detoxification of poisons containing arsenic or mercury, and… lowongan sime darby oilWebMay 10, 2024 · The cost per unit is: ($30,000 Fixed costs + $50,000 variable costs) ÷ 10,000 units = $8 cost per unit. In the following month, ABC produces 5,000 units at a variable cost of $25,000 and the same fixed cost of $30,000. The cost per unit is: ($30,000 Fixed costs + $25,000 variable costs) ÷ 5,000 units = $11/unit.
